South Carolina men's, women's basketball teams set to participate in 2024 NCAA Tournaments

The South Carolina men's and women's basketball teams are set to compete in their respective NCAA Tournaments after both tournaments' brackets were revealed Sunday night.

This year's tournament will be the first time both Gamecock basketball teams have participated in March Madness at the same time since 2017, when the men reached the Final Four and the women captured the program's first-ever national title.

The South Carolina men's basketball team will enter the tournament as a No. 6 seed, its highest NCAA Tournament seed since 1998 when it was a No. 3 seed. The Gamecocks received an at-large bid after falling to Auburn in the quarterfinal round of the SEC Tournament on Friday.

South Carolina will face off against No. 11 seed Oregon, who finished the regular season with a 20-11 record and won the PAC-12 Tournament, in the opening round of the tournament. The Gamecocks will take on the winner of No. 3 seed Creighton and No. 14 seed Akron if it advances to the round of 32.

Tipoff will be at 4 p.m. on Thursday, and the game will be broadcast on TNT. 

The South Carolina women's basketball team received an automatic bid to the NCAA Tournament after beating LSU 79-72 in the SEC Tournament Championship game on March 10. The Gamecocks will enter the tournament as a No. 1 seed for the fourth straight season and play its first and second-round games at Colonial Life Arena.

South Carolina's first game of the tournament will come against the winner of two No. 16 seeds — Sacred Heart and Presbyterian — that will play against each other in a First Four matchup early next week. Sacred Heart earned an automatic bid after winning the Northeast Conference Tournament, and Presbyterian will compete in its first-ever NCAA Tournament as a Division I program after capturing a Big South Tournament title.

No. 8 seed North Carolina and No. 9 seed Michigan State will also play a round of 64 contest in Colonial Life Arena, and the winner of that game will take on the Gamecocks if it emerges victorious in the opening round.
